Subject: Re: Question about multiple installs
References: <20010522005244 DOT 2BAEB8B10 AT bellmann DOT research DOT canon DOT com DOT au>

> To save on bandwidth, for doing multiple installs of Cygwin across many
> machines, is it simply a matter of mirroring one of the mirrors
> locally, and then running the setup program and directing it fetch
> files from the local network?

Yes.  Make sure you preserve the directory structure.  Or, install
cygwin on any one machine.  Setup will prompt you for a local
directory (which defaults to the current directory).  When setup is
done, all the files you need will have already been correctly mirrored
to that directory.

> But must the local installation files be accessible by ftp, or can they
> simply be local files on a shared drive?

Setup can install from ftp, http, or a local directory.  For a local
directory, choose "install from local directory" instead of "install
from internet".
